Multifamily variety at Stapleton

This block, adjacent to the first neighborhood green at Stapleton, features stacked flats facing the green and rowhouses facing away. When mixing housing types on one block, it is better to have different types facing across an alley than a street. The rowhouses, like many three- and four-story rowhouses today, have an updated version of an English basement. The ground-level first floor houses a garage and multipurpose room, with the living areas upstairs.

Affordable condos at Stapleton

"Syracuse Village" offers condominiums from the $100s to income-qualified buyers at Stapleton in Denver. Note the subtle ramps along the side for accessibility. These appear to have eight flats per building.

Vancouver low-rise

Everyone knows about the towers of downtown Vancouver, but the city has also vigorously pursued neighborhood infill. The blocks around a former brewery on Arbutus Avenue in Kitsilano, an upscale neighbourhood south of downtown, have been redeveloped in recent years. This smaller-scale development is east of Arbutus -- both are new and of similar scale, but one takes a (modernised) three-flat as prototype and the other copies large Victorian houses.
